WebTo start shooting real estate photography, you just need to head out with your camera, a wide-angle lens, (or the shortest focal length that you have), and a sturdy tripod. The rest … WebFiguring out your camera settings for real estate photography interiors is a bit more complicated, namely because you can have weird amounts of light in different rooms of a house. For rooms with plenty of natural light, set your camera settings here to start: Exposure mode - aperture priority. Aperture - f/8. the people\\u0027s defender https://ilikehair.net
